14. Boll Weevil Monument

Enterprise, Coffee County
The Boll Weevil is a beetle that destroys cotton buds and bolls. After it entered Alabama in 1910, it devastated the cotton crop,
and farmers in the Wiregrass turned to peanut farming, which actually proved more profitable. The citizens of Enterprise dedicated
the Boll Weevil Monument in 1919 in mock appreciation of the Boll Weevil which compelled farmers to diversify their crops.
